Main Control Valve Body: Installation

WARNING: This page is about a different car, the 2002 Ford Ranger. However, it is still accessible from the selected car via links, so may be relevant.
  1. Install the special tool into the transmission case.
    Fig 1: Installing Special Tool Into Transmission Case
    G02152424Courtesy of FORD MOTOR CO.
  2. Position the main control valve body with the two special tools as a guide.
    Fig 2: Positioning Main Control Valve Body With Special Tools As Guide
    G02152425Courtesy of FORD MOTOR CO.
  3. NOTE: The main control valve body screws will be tightened in later steps.
    Fig 3: Installing Main Control Valve Body Screws (M6 x 45 mm)
    G02152426Courtesy of FORD MOTOR CO.
  4. Loosely install four M6 x 45 mm (1.8 in) screws.
  5. NOTE: The main control valve body screws will be tightened in later steps.
    Fig 4: Installing Main Control Valve Body Screws (M6 x 35 mm)
    G02152427Courtesy of FORD MOTOR CO.
  6. Loosely install two M6 x 35 mm (1.4 in) screws.
  7. Remove the special tools.
  8. NOTE: The main control valve body screws will be tightened in later steps.
    Fig 5: Installing Main Control Valve Body Screw (M6 x 30 mm)
    G02152428Courtesy of FORD MOTOR CO.
  9. Loosely install the M6 x 30 mm (1.2 in) screw.
  10. NOTE: The main control valve body screws will be tightened in later steps.
    Fig 6: Installing Main Control Valve Body Screws (M6 x 40 mm)
    G02152429Courtesy of FORD MOTOR CO.
  11. Loosely install the sixteen M6 x 40 mm (1.6 in) main control valve body screws.
  12. Tighten the main control valve body screws in the sequence shown.
    Fig 7: Main Control Valve Body Screw Tightening Sequence
    G02152430Courtesy of FORD MOTOR CO.
  13. Rotate the manual lever into the NEUTRAL position.
  14. Install the manual control valve detent lever spring.
    Fig 8: Installing Manual Control Valve Detent Lever Spring
    G02152431Courtesy of FORD MOTOR CO.
  15. Install the low/reverse band servo piston and rod.
    Fig 9: Installing Low/Reverse Band Servo Piston & Rod
    G02152432Courtesy of FORD MOTOR CO.
  16. Install the low/reverse band servo cover.
    1. Install the low/reverse band servo cover and gasket.
    2. Loosely install the low/reverse servo piston cover screws.
    Fig 10: Installing Low/Reverse Band Servo Cover
    G02152433Courtesy of FORD MOTOR CO.
  17. Tighten the servo cover screws in the sequence shown.
    Fig 11: Servo Cover Screw Tightening Sequence
    G02152434Courtesy of FORD MOTOR CO.
  18. Connect the six solenoid electrical connectors.
    1. Connect SSA, SSB, SSC, and SSD electrical connectors.
    2. Connect the Torque Converter Clutch (TCC) solenoid electrical connector.
    3. Connect the Electronic Pressure Control (EPC) solenoid electrical connector.
    Fig 12: Connecting Solenoid Electrical Connectors
    G02152435Courtesy of FORD MOTOR CO.
  19. CAUTION: Excessive pressure may break the locating pins.
    Fig 13: Installing Main Control Valve Body Wire Harness
    G02152436Courtesy of FORD MOTOR CO.
  20. Install the main control valve body wire harness.
    • Align the retaining pins to the holes in the solenoid clamps and press in the main control valve body wire harness guide and protector.
  21. Install the transmission fluid filter.
    1. Install the transmission fluid filter.
    2. Install the transmission fluid filter screw.
    Fig 14: Installing Transmission Fluid Filter & Screw
    G02152437Courtesy of FORD MOTOR CO.
  22. Install the transmission fluid pan.
    1. Position a new transmission fluid pan gasket on the transmission fluid pan.
    2. Install and align the transmission fluid pan.
    Fig 15: Positioning Transmission Fluid Pan & Gasket
    G02152438Courtesy of FORD MOTOR CO.
  23. Tighten the transmission fluid pan screws.
    • Tighten the transmission fluid pan screws in a crisscross sequence.
    Fig 16: Tightening Transmission Fluid Pan Screws
    G02152439Courtesy of FORD MOTOR CO.
  24. CAUTION: Tightening one screw before tightening the other may cause the sensor to bind or become damaged.
    NOTE: The manual lever must be in the NEUTRAL position.
    Fig 17: Aligning Digital TR Sensor
    G02152440Courtesy of FORD MOTOR CO.
  25. Using the special tool, align the digital TR sensor and tighten screws in an alternating sequence.
  26. Install the manual control outer lever and nut.
    Fig 18: Installing Manual Control Outer Lever & Nut
    G02152441Courtesy of FORD MOTOR CO.
  27. Connect the digital Transmission Range (TR) sensor electrical connector.
    Fig 19: Connecting Digital TR Sensor Electrical Connector
    G02152442Courtesy of FORD MOTOR CO.
  28. Connect the shift cable to the manual control lever.
    Fig 20: Connecting Shift Cable To Manual Control Lever
    G02152443Courtesy of FORD MOTOR CO.
  29. If equipped, position the servo heat shield over the servos and clip it to the pan rail.
    Fig 21: Installing Servo Heat Shield
    G02152444Courtesy of FORD MOTOR CO.
  30. NOTE: If the vehicle was not equipped with a fluid filter, install a fluid filter kit. Follow the instructions supplied in the kit. If the vehicle was equipped with a filter, install a new filter.
    Fig 22: Installing In-Line Transmission Fluid Filter
    G02152445Courtesy of FORD MOTOR CO.
  31. Install a new in-line transmission fluid filter kit or filter.
  32. Lower the vehicle.
  33. NOTE: When the battery has been disconnected and reconnected, some abnormal drive symptoms can occur while the vehicle relearns its adaptive strategy. The customer needs to be notified that they may experience slightly different upshifts either soft or firm and this is a temporary condition and will eventually return to normal operating condition.
  34. Connect the battery ground cable. For additional information, refer to BATTERY, MOUNTING AND CABLES .
  35. Fill the transmission to the correct fluid level and check for correct transmission operation.
